Noun

standardizationRareUSact of making something common or sharedRareUS
  • The commonization of software platforms improved compatibility.
  • The commonization of mobile chargers reduced electronic waste.
  • Commonization in language can bridge cultural gaps.
standardization uniformity

Origin of commonization

English, common (shared) + -ization (process of making)
